This is a collection of funny stories, both traditional and contemporary, from writers such as Michael Rosen, Paul Jennings, Margaret Mahy, Virginia Haviland, Helen Cresswell, Robert Newton Peck and Anne Fine. The stories feature characters such as Posy Bates, Dilly the Dinosaur and dancing cows.

"Dirty Dilly", Tony Bradman; "Anancy and the Tiger - A Caribbean Tale", retold by Andrew Matthews; "Posy Bates - Inventor", Helen Cresswell; "Doctor Boox and the Sore Giraffe", Andrew Davies; "Crummy Mummy", Anne Fine; "UFD", Paul Jennings; "Miss Mee in a Muddle", Margaret Joy; "Harry's Aunt", Sheila Lavelle; "The Librarian and the Robbers", Margaret Mahy; "William's Version", Jan Mark; "And a Partridge in a Pear Tree", Andrew Matthews; "But You Promised You Wouldn't Tell", Bel Mooney; "Apples and Stetson", Robert Newton Peck; "The Night Thing", Michael Rosen; "Strong but Quirky", Irwin Shapiro; "The Case of the Smell - A Chinese Story", retold by Mark Cohen.
